Caption | (A-C) lateral view, posterior to right. (A) Sagittal section of a mid-primitive streak stage embryo, the extraembryonic VE (arrowhead). (B) Full-length primitive streak stage embryo with endoderm removed, nascent embryonic mesoderm (arrow). (C) Early head-fold stage embryo, the visceral endoderm (arrowhead), mesoderm adjacent to the primitive streak (arrow). (D) A proximal transverse section of the embryo in (C), mesodermal component of the primitive streak (arrow), the VE (arrowhead). Scale bar: 140 microns, (A); 105 microns, (B); 250 microns, (C); 135 microns, (D). | |||||||||||||||
